Key Ingredients
The main ingredients in this easy corn salad include fresh corn kernels, red onion, bell pepper, cilantro, lime juice, olive oil, salt, and pepper. For the dressing, you’ll need mayonnaise, sour cream, and a bit of honey for sweetness. These ingredients can be substituted or adjusted based on personal preferences. For example, you can use Greek yogurt instead of sour cream for a lighter version, or add some diced jalapeños for an extra kick of spice. Instructions
- Step 1: Begin by preparing your ingredients. Chop the red onion and bell pepper into small, bite-sized pieces. If using fresh corn, boil the ears for about 5 minutes until slightly tender, then let them cool before scraping off the kernels. Chop the cilantro leaves and set aside.
- Step 2: In a large bowl, combine the corn kernels, chopped onion, bell pepper, and cilantro. Squeeze the lime juice over the mixture and toss gently to combine. This step helps to bring out the natural sweetness of the corn and adds a burst of citrus flavor.
- Step 3: In a small b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, sour cream, honey, salt, and pepper to make the dressing. Taste and adjust the seasoning as needed. You can add more lime juice, salt, or honey to get the perfect balance of flavors.
- Step 4: Pour the dressing over the corn mixture and toss until everything is well combined.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ld together. Before serving, give the salad a good stir and adjust the seasoning if necessary.
Handy Tips
- For the best flavor, use fresh ingredients whenever possible. Fresh corn, especially, makes a big difference in the taste and texture of the salad.
- Don’t overdress the salad. You want the corn and vegetables to still have a bit of crunch and freshness. Start with the recommended amount of dressing and add more to taste.
- Consider adding some protein like cooked chicken, bacon, or black beans to make the salad more substantial and filling.
Heat Control
If you’re using fresh corn, the brief boiling time is crucial. You want the corn to be slightly tender but still crisp. Overcooking can make the corn mushy and unappetizing. For the dressing, there’s no cooking involved, but make sure to refrigerate the salad for at least 30 min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ld together and the ingredients to chill.
Crunch Factor
The crunch in this salad comes from the fresh vegetables and the slight crunch of the corn kernels. To maintain this texture, avoid overcooking the corn and don’t overdress the salad, as excess dressing can make the ingredients soggy. If you’re looking for extra crunch, consider adding some toasted nuts or seeds like almonds or pumpkin seeds.
Pro Kitchen Tricks
- To remove the kernels from the cob without making a mess, place the ear of corn in a large bowl and use a sharp knife to slice off the kernels. The bowl will catch any stray kernels.
- For an extra creamy dressing, add a tablespoon or two of plain Greek yogurt. This will not only add creaminess but also a bit of tanginess.
- Experiment with different types of peppers or onions to change up the flavor. For example, using red bell pepper instead of green can add a sweeter flavor to the salad.
Storage Tips
- This salad can be made ahead of time and stored in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. Give it a good stir before serving and adjust the seasoning if needed.
-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. It’s best to consume it fresh, but it will still be delicious and safe to eat within this timeframe.
- Avoid freezing this salad as the mayonnaise and sour cream can separate and become watery when thawed.

Flavor Variations
- 🌟 Different spices: Add a pinch of cumin or smoked paprika to give the salad a smoky flavor. Chili powder or diced jalapeños can add a spicy kick.
- 🌟 Creative toppings: Consider adding diced tomatoes, avocado, or crumbled feta cheese to the salad for extra flavor and texture.
- 🌟 Ingredient swaps: Use diced zucchini or carrots instead of bell pepper for a different crunch and flavor. You can also swap the mayonnaise with avocado oil or another oil of your choice for a lighter dressing.
Troubleshooting
- Texture problems: If the salad becomes too soggy, it might be due to overcooking the corn or using too much dressing. Try adding more corn kernels or vegetables to balance it out.
- Ingredient replacements: If you’re allergic to mayonnaise or prefer not to use it, you can substitute it with plain Greek yogurt or sour cream. Just adjust the amount of honey or lime juice accordingly to balance the flavor.
- Over/undercooking signs: The corn should be slightly tender but still crisp. If it’s mushy, it’s overcooked. For the dressing, refrigerate it for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ld together.
FAQs
- Can I freeze it? It’s not recommended to freeze this salad due to the mayonnaise and sour cream, which can separate and become watery when thawed.
- Is it gluten-free? Yes, this salad is naturally gluten-free, making it a great option for those with gluten intolerance or sensitivity. Just be sure to check the ingredients of the mayonnaise and any store-bought items to ensure they are gluten-free.
- Can I double the recipe? Absolutely! This salad is perfect for large gatherings or potlucks. Simply double or triple the ingredients as needed, and adjust the dressing accordingly to ensure everything is well coated but not soggy.
